Output 75a40691da81540b976848e16313c02f649c2ac26eb0bd594a27d1ffe956ae13:191

value
68443
script pubkey
OP_0 OP_PUSHBYTES_32 3c31462a5073ada412fd68c5a11c60ff335ad9dba8fb56146c5ef59c29c7b78f
address
bc1q8sc5v2jswwk6gyhadrz6z8rqlue44kwm4ra4v9rvtm6ec2w8k78sg025fc
transaction
75a40691da81540b976848e16313c02f649c2ac26eb0bd594a27d1ffe956ae13
spent
true